Merge branch 'addmainunit3-altlink' into addmainunit3-altlink-sharedstmt
[lldb.git] / libcxx / src /
2021-01-15 Reid KlecknerFix libc++ clang-cl build, swap attribute order
2021-01-12 Martin Storsjö[libcxx] Avoid overflows in the windows __libcpp_steady...
2021-01-08 Louis Dionne[libc++/abi] Re-remove unnecessary null pointer checks...
2021-01-07 Martin Storsjö[libcxx] Handle backslash as path separator on windows
2020-12-18 Martin Storsjö[libcxx] Fix the preexisting directory_iterator code...
2020-12-18 Martin Storsjö[libcxx] Convert paths to/from the right narrow code...
2020-12-18 Martin Storsjö[libcxx] Make filesystem::path::value_type wchar_t...
2020-12-10 Marek Kurdej[libc++] [P1164] [C++20] Make fs::create_directory...
2020-12-02 Marek Kurdej[libc++] [P0482] [C++20] Implement missing bits for...
2020-11-27 Bruce Mitchener[libc++] Replace several uses of 0 by nullptr
2020-11-26 Louis Dionne[libc++] Remove sysctl-based implementation of thread...
2020-11-25 Louis Dionne[libc++] Factor out common logic for calling aligned...
2020-11-20 Zbigniew SarbinowskiGuard init_priority attribute within libc++
2020-11-18 Xiang Xiao[libcxx] Port to NuttX (https://nuttx.apache.org) RTOS
2020-11-13 Louis Dionne[libc++] Only check for GCC's empty string storage...
2020-11-13 Zbigniew Sarbinowski[libc++] Port the time functions to z/OS
2020-11-12 Louis Dionne[libc++] Instantiate additional <iostream> members...
2020-11-12 Louis DionneRevert "[SystemZ][ZOS] Porting the time functions withi...
2020-11-12 Zbigniew Sarbinowski[SystemZ][ZOS] Porting the time functions within libc...
2020-11-11 Louis Dionne[libc++] NFC: Synchronize libc++abi and libc++ new...
2020-11-10 Sam Clegg[libc++] Remove emscripten handling from exception_fall...
2020-11-09 Louis Dionne[runtimes] Avoid overwriting the rpath unconditionally
2020-11-05 Louis Dionne[libc++] Rework the whole availability markup implement...
2020-11-04 Louis Dionne[libc++] NFCI: Refactor chrono.cpp to make it easier...
2020-11-03 Martin Storsjö[libcxx] Error out if __libcpp_mbsrtowcs_l fails in...
2020-11-03 Martin Storsjö[libcxx] Avoid double frees of file descriptors in...
2020-11-02 Louis Dionne[libc++] Split off iostreams explicit instantiations...
2020-10-30 Louis Dionne[libc++] Fix tests failing with Clang after removing...
2020-10-30 Louis Dionne[libc++] NFC: Fix several GCC warnings in the test...
2020-10-28 YAMAMOTO Takashi[libc++] Fix a few warnings
2020-10-27 Louis Dionne[libc++] Add a libc++ configuration that does not suppo...
2020-10-26 Louis Dionne[libc++] Add a CI jobs to test the Standalone builds
2020-10-23 Louis Dionne[libc++] Refactor the run-buildbot script to make it...
2020-10-20 Eric Fiselier[libc++] Make __shared_weak_count vtable consistent...
2020-10-19 Louis Dionne[libc++] Define new/delete in libc++abi only by default
2020-10-15 Louis Dionne[libc++][filesystem] Only include <fstream> when we...
2020-10-15 Louis Dionne[libc++] NFC: Remove unused include
2020-10-15 Louis Dionne[libc++] Allow building libc++ on platforms without...
2020-10-09 Louis Dionne[libc++] Remove redundant if(LIBCXX_INSTALL_LIBRARY)
2020-10-09 Louis Dionne[libc++] Rename LIBCXX_ENABLE_DEBUG_MODE to LIBCXX_ENAB...
2020-10-07 Nico Weber[gn build] (manually) port ce1365f8f7e
2020-10-07 Louis Dionne[libc++] Add a CMake option to control whether the...
2020-10-06 Hafiz Abid Qadeer[libc++] Check _LIBCPP_USE_CLOCK_GETTIME before using...
2020-10-05 Louis Dionne[libc++] Use __has_include instead of complex logic...
2020-10-05 Louis Dionne[libc++] NFC: Remove unused <iostream> include in atomi...
2020-10-05 Louis Dionne[libc++/abi] Revert "[libc++] Move the weak symbols...
2020-10-02 Louis Dionne[libc++] Move the weak symbols list to libc++abi
2020-10-01 Louis Dionne[libc++] Don't re-export new/delete from libc++abi...
2020-10-01 Louis Dionne[libc++] Simplify how we re-export symbols from libc...
2020-09-16 Louis Dionne[libc++] Ensure streams are initialized early
2020-09-01 David Nicuesa[libcxx] Link target `cxx_external_threads` to `cxx...
2020-08-27 Mikhail MaltsevRevert "[libcxx] Fix compile for BUILD_EXTERNAL_THREAD_...
2020-08-27 David Nicuesa[libcxx] Fix compile for BUILD_EXTERNAL_THREAD_LIBRARY
2020-07-22 Louis Dionne[libc++] Build the dylib with C++17 to allow aligned...
2020-07-14 Louis Dionne[libc++] Use a proper CMake target to represent libc...
2020-07-08 Louis Dionne[libc++] Install PSTL when installing libc++ with paral...
2020-06-30 Louis Dionne[libc++] Split dylib instantiations for deprecated...
2020-06-09 Louis Dionne[libc++] Remove workarounds for the lack of clock_getti...
2020-05-22 Louis Dionne[libc++] Mark __u64toa and __u32toa as noexcept
2020-05-14 John Brawn[libc++] Adjust how we guard the inclusion of unistd.h
2020-05-07 Mara Sophie Grosch[libc++] chrono: check _POSIX_TIMERS before using clock...
2020-05-04 Louis Dionne[libc++] NFC: Remove outdated #if comment
2020-04-28 Saleem Abdulrasoolbuild: update libc++ as there are some bots with integr...
2020-04-20 Louis Dionne[libc++] Fix the no-exceptions build of libc++ on Apple
2020-03-30 Louis DionneRemove legacy CMake targets for libcxx and libcxxabi
2020-03-25 Louis DionneRevert "[libc++] Build the dylib with C++17 to allow...
2020-03-24 Louis Dionne[libc++] Build the dylib with C++17 to allow aligned...
2020-03-24 Louis Dionne[libc++] Fix installation of cxx_experimental
2020-03-23 Louis DionneRevert "Remove legacy CMake targets for libcxx and...
2020-03-23 Louis DionneRemove legacy CMake targets for libcxx and libcxxabi
2020-03-02 Martijn VelsAdd flag _LIBCPP_ABI_STRING_OPTIMIZED_EXTERNAL_INSTANTI...
2020-02-27 ogirouxSome fixes for open breaks on MacOS and UBSan
2020-02-24 Louis Dionne[libc++] Drop redundant check for -std=c++14
2020-02-24 Olivier Giroux[libc++] Implementation of C++20's P1135R6 for libcxx
2020-02-21 Martijn VelsSplit _LIBCPP_STRING_EXTERN_TEMPLATE_LIST up into a...
2020-02-12 Louis Dionne[libc++][Apple] Use CLOCK_MONOTONIC_RAW instead of...
2020-01-29 Martin Storsjö[libcxx] [Windows] Store the lconv struct returned...
2020-01-23 Joerg SonnenbergerReplace old-style cast of null pointer with nullptr
2020-01-15 Eric Fiselier[libc++] Explicitly enumerate std::string external...
2020-01-14 Martin Storsjö[libcxx] [Windows] Make a more proper implementation...
2020-01-13 Oliver StannardRevert "[libc++] Explicitly enumerate std::string exter...
2020-01-09 Eric Fiselier[libc++] Explicitly enumerate std::string external...
2019-12-02 Michał Górny[libcxx{,abi}] Emit deplibs only when detected by CMake
2019-11-09 Mark de Wever[libc++] Validate the entire regex is consumed
2019-10-23 Stephan T. Lavavej[libcxx][NFC] Strip trailing whitespace, fix typo.
2019-10-23 Casey Carter[libc++][NFC] Remove excess trailing newlines from...
2019-10-08 Louis Dionne[libc++] Move the linker script generation step to...
2019-10-08 Louis Dionne[libc++] Make sure we link all system libraries into...
2019-10-08 Louis Dionne[libc++] TAKE 2: Make system libraries PRIVATE dependen...
2019-10-04 Alex Langford[libc++] Guard cxx_experimental settings behind LIBCXX_...
2019-10-04 Louis Dionne[libc++] Localize common build flags into a single...
2019-10-04 Louis Dionne[libc++] Move more CMake flags to per-target definitions
2019-10-03 Louis Dionne[libc++] Add a per-target flag to include the generated...
2019-10-02 Louis Dionne[libc++] Use functions instead of global variables...
2019-10-02 Louis Dionne[libc++] Use a function to set warning flags per target
2019-10-02 Louis Dionne[libc++] Revert to using PUBLIC instead of PRIVATE...
2019-10-02 Louis Dionne[libc++] Use PRIVATE instead of PUBLIC when linking...
2019-09-26 Louis Dionne[libc++] Take 2: Implement LWG 2510
2019-09-25 Ilya BiryukovRevert r372777: [libc++] Implement LWG 2510 and its...
2019-09-24 Louis Dionne[libc++] Implement LWG 2510
next